
Afrobeats singer Mayorkun (real name, Emmanuel Adewale) says he is contemplating relocating out of Nigeria amid hardship in the country.
“I dey reason to japa [relocate],” the ‘Mayor of Lagos’ crooner wrote in a post on his X handle on Monday.
Nigerians have been caught in the throes of a debilitating hardship in the last two years, triggered by the economic policies of the Bola Tinubu-led Federal Government.
In the midst of it all, the ‘Japa Syndrome’ – relocation abroad – which has been ongoing has assumed a heightened dimension. And Nigerian celebrities have not been left out as a number of them have also moved abroad.
Daily Post reports that notable celebrities like Tacha, Eldee, Dr. Sid, Genevieve Nnaji, Omotola Jalade Ekeinde, Rita Dominic, Uche Jombo, Emeka Ike, and many others have relocated from the country within the past decade.
Last year, veteran singer Banky W announced that he had relocated to the United States with his family for educational purposes.
